Eric Olson has over 35 years of litigation experience including 30 years as a trademark litigation paralegal. He began working with Lou Pirkey and Bill Barber at Arnold, White & Durkee in 1993. He has been actively engaged in all aspects of U.S. trademark litigation, portfolio management, and enforcement across a broad range of industries.

Eric’s primary focus involves handling cases involved in trademark litigation in federal courts throughout the U.S. and before the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office Trademark Trial and Appeal Board.

Eric has considerable expertise in managing trademark disputes including oppositions, cancellations, watch management, and third-party infringement claims. He is also well-versed in advising on domain name disputes under ICANN’s domain name dispute resolution policies.
